Offer description

The Works Delivery Manager is the senior leader for the Eastern and Anglia route reactive works. The role covers overall responsibility for the delivery of the work bank, including HSEQ, quality and financial performance of reactive contracts (with support from the QS). Key duties involve coordinating all aspects of reactive and PPM works to meet client expectations, ensuring compliance with standard operating procedures and SISK HSEQS policies, maintaining accurate documentation and handback, and finding opportunities to add value or enhance earnings. The role is based at the Stansted office with regular travel required.


Responsibilities


Clients

* Liaise with customers, their representatives and all stakeholders on operational issues.
* Develop and strengthen valuable business relationships.
* Respond to changes in client and stakeholder needs and expectations.
* Manage key stakeholders throughout the project life cycle.


Project Delivery

* Lead and coordinate geographically located or skilled-based supervisors and operatives.
* Oversee subcontractor delivery across routes.
* Implement HSQE controls, including CPP/WPP and TBS.
* Ensure all work is set up safely and securely following client and SISK processes.
* Actively participate in HSEQS management and challenge sub‑par practices on site.
* Plan and coordinate internal and external resource levels for timely, safe, quality execution.
* Monitor progress and identify improvement areas.
* Sample work for quality before client presentation.
* Arrange rectification of defects and update the client and site team.
* Manage open orders to keep KPIs within limits.
* Support the team on high‑priority/reactive works.
* Assist with booking possessions, isolations and other access forms.


Reporting

* Attend and document reactive, subcontractor and internal meetings.
* Produce an achievable programme, monitor milestones, and report weekly to client and line manager.
* Escalate issues promptly to the line manager.
* Maintain all project records and data systems for client access.


Risk

* Secure all necessary approvals to progress without risk.
* Conduct monthly risk reviews for high‑risk activities with the Contracts Manager.
* Review buildability and design methods to deliver an achievable project, including temporary works.
* Identify non‑conformances and implement corrective action.
* Notify QS of any matters related to extra payment or cost implications.
* Close out issues raised by safety, quality and environmental reports and audits.


People

* Manage the reactive team, supervise, develop staff and ensure competency.
* Live the SISK values of Care, Integrity and Excellence in all activities.
* Provide business support to site supervisors and operations teams.
* Act as a SISK ambassador at external events.
* Lead and manage sub‑contractors and in‑house delivery teams.
* Be an inspiring role model for the wider team.


Commercial

* Support the commercial team with external commercial requirements.
* Update project programmes to support prolongation and EOT claims.
* Assist the commercial team with internal forecasting and performance.
* Help prepare quotations and adjudications within ICRM documents.
* Follow company protocol for engagement, approval and signing of invoices/payments.


Experience

* Strong written and verbal communication skills, adaptable to audience and style.
* Minimum 5 years in a project‑management environment within a national or regional contractor, with a record of high HSEQS standards.
* Strong analytical skills.
* Organised with good time management and proactive planning.
* Ability to get the best out of individuals, teams and trade contractors.
* Manage safety performance in line with the SISK safety code.
* Manage people performance in line with the SISK HR code.
* Know and apply company commercial procedures to all activities.
* Comprehensive knowledge of all required trades, codes of practice and site requirements.
* Delivery focused and performance driven.
* Computer literate.


Qualifications


Essential

* Working towards an academic or professional industry‑related qualification.
* CSCS for Managers, SMSTS.
* First Aid at Work certificate.
* CDM Awareness.
* Driving licence.


Desirable

* Degree or Diploma in a construction‑related subject.
* Personal track safety.
* Mandatory training in line with the SISK Rail Training Matrix.
